after some people had mentioned Agbrigg chrome platers i thought i would give them a try as the lead time was less than most. I emailed first to see if they were still working as it was in last lockdown, and Sean was very prompt at replying so i sent them off a few weeks ago. Yesterday he rang to say they were ready, i paid with paypal, and lo and behold they arrived today. I had 2 fork ears and 2 indicator stems done for my 550 and they turned out nice, £70 delivered so well chuffed, can recommend.
